Henan Jian Ye (CHN)

Henan Construction (Chinese: 河南建业; pinyin: Hénán Jiànyè) is a Chinese professional football club based in Zhengzhou (Simplified Chinese: 郑州), in the province of Henan (Simplified Chinese: 河南省), China. The clubs predecessor was the Henan Provincial team who were founded in 1958 while the current professional football team was establish in August 27, 1994. The club received promotion to the Chinese Super League after winning the 2006 Chinese Jia League title. The club have never won the league title and the highest position they have ever achieved was when they came third in the 2009 Chinese Super League season.

The football club were originally known as Henan Provincial team and were founded in 1958 when the Chinese football league system were gradually expanding. The team often spent much of it’s time in the second tier except for a short period during the late 1970’s when the league was expanded to accommodate more teams. When the Chinese football league system grew to accommodate a third tier Henan found themselves relegated from the second tier in the 1981 league season, however they were able to quickly return to the second tier when they came top of the table to win premotion in the 1982 league season. It wasn’t long until they won premotion to the top tier once more in the 1985 league season where they would remain until the 1988 league season when they were relegated at the end of the season.

By the 1994 league season the entire Chinese football league system had become professional and Henan would quickly follow when they became professional in August 27, 1994 and would rename themselves Henan Jianye[3]. Henan’s transition toward professionalism was differcult and they were once more relegated at the end of the 1994 league season to the third tier[4]. Once again they would have to win premotion from the third tier when they came runners-up in the table at the 1995 league season. For several season they were a second tier club fighting against relegation until they won premotion to the Chinese Super League at the end of the 2006 league season. In their debut season in the top tier playing professional football Henan brought in Jia Xiuquan to add experience to their management and to help them avoid relegation, which he achieved when they finished the season in 12th position, narrowly avoiding relegation after defeating Changchun Yatai for 3:2. While he helped avoid relegation in his debut season the following 2008 league season saw Henan start the season slowly and they quickly demanded results, which saw Tang Yaodong eventually named as manager to help them avoid relegation once more.
